Farm Clearing in Salt Lake City, UT
Farm clearing services involve the removal of trees, brush, stumps, and other vegetation to prepare a property for development, farming, or landscaping projects. These services are commonly requested for projects such as building new structures, creating pasture land, installing fencing, or improving land accessibility.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of clearing, including what types of vegetation will be removed, the extent of land coverage, and any potential impact on the landscape. Clarifying these details beforehand helps ensure the project meets expectations and aligns with future land use plans.
Before requesting farm clearing services, property owners should consider factors such as property size, the presence of existing structures or utilities, and any local regulations or permits that may be required. It’s also helpful to determine whether the project involves clearing for agricultural purposes, construction, or aesthetic improvements, as this can influence the methods and equipment used. Having a clear understanding of the desired outcome and any site-specific considerations can assist in planning a smooth and efficient clearing process.

Farm Clearing Questions
What types of properties can benefit from farm clearing? Farm clearing services are suitable for residential farms, ranches, and large rural properties needing vegetation removal or land preparation.
What equipment is used during farm clearing? He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and mowers are commonly used to efficiently clear land and remove unwanted growth.
What is the main purpose of farm clearing? The primary goal is to prepare land for farming, construction, or pasture development by removing trees, brush, and debris.
What should property owners consider before farm clearing? It is important to assess land features, identify any protected plants or structures, and plan for proper disposal of cleared material.
